Full-Time Officer Roundup - Term 3

We’re approaching the end of the academic year, and your Full-Time Officer team have been working hard to advocate for students’ interests.

Whilst we were sad to see 3 of our Full-Time Officers leave, we were delighted that Olly, Charlotte and Megan have secured new jobs, and wish them the best of luck.

Take a look at some of the team’s achievements in this FTO Term 3 Roundup!

  • Launched ‘Party Smart’, a welfare campaign for drug and alcohol harm reduction, to support students in making informed choices, and in staying as safe as possible.
  • Pushed the University to open up additional study space for Term 3, including spaces for students to take exams.
  • Continue to lobby the University to ensure as much teaching as possible is in-person in Term 1. Also have been ensuring students’ voices are heard in future plans for blended learning.
  • Pushed for further diversification and flexibility of assessment methods, allowing students to choose how they want to be assessed.
  • Facilitated ‘Summer of Sport’, by supporting sports clubs in running free taster sessions, open to all students.
  • Held our annual Union Awards, which celebrate students and groups who have made an impact on campus through campaigning and activism or the organisation of society events.
  • Held our Summer Elections and successfully elected five new Student Trustees to oversee the SU’s finances and governance, as well as Associations Execs to lead our brand new Liberation Associations.
  • Supported the Term 3 Active Bystander Intervention Course, which focuses on the prevention of sexual misconduct and violence to develop the knowledge, skills and confidence to be an Active Bystander.
  • Celebrated University staff members who have gone above and beyond, in our annual Transforming Education Awards.
  • Launched Warwick SU’s 2021-25 Strategic Plan, which sets out the SU’s plans for the next five years and how we can be held accountable for delivering them.
